Abstract
713,105. Electric analogne calculating systems. BRITISH IRON & STEEL RESEARCH ASSOCIATION. Nov. 25, 1952, [Nov. 27, 1951.] No. 27797/51. Class 37. [Also in Groups XXII and XXXVIII] A method of measuring the thickness of sheet or strip emergent from a rolling or drawing mill comprises the derivation of a 1st signal proportionate to the separating force on the rollers or dies, and a 2nd signal proportionate to the setting of the rollers or dies the proportionality factor of the 1st signal being a predetermined number of times greater than that of the 2nd signal and determined by the elasticity of the mill structure, and the signals being added to give a sum signal representative of the thickness of the emergent material. In Fig. i the slider of a potentiometer R 2 energized from a battery B 2 through a variable resistance P 2 determining the proportionality factor is adjusted in accordance with the required mean thickness h<SP>1</SP> of material emerging from a rolling mill (Fig. 3) wherein rollers 23, 24 may be set to a predetermined separation by a screw 27 co-operating with worm gearing 26 driven by a handwheel 25 to produce a representative voltage which is connected to a zeroizing slider 11 of potentiometer Ri energized through a variable resistance P I determining the proportionality factor from battery Bi; the operative slider 10 of which is adjusted in accordance with the roll setting So of the mill by e.g. rotating a drum 29 carrying the resistance winding 30 past a fixed sliding contact 31 engaging the wire. A stress indicator 28 such as that described in Specification 626,206 comprising four resistance strain gauges connected in a Wheatstone bridge 12 is supported in the mill structure to respond to the mean separating force F exerted on the rollers during passage of the material and is energized from a battery to produce an unbalance voltage (measurable by meter M 2 ) representing the quantity F - where M is a proportionality constant depen- M dent on the elasticity of the mill structure and a predetermined multiple of the constant affecting the roll setting. It is shown that if #h is the difference betewen the required mean thickness h<SP>1</SP> and the mean thicknesses produced, and the representative voltages are thus combined in appropriate polarities at the input of an interrupter type D.C. amplifier 16 whose output energizes a centre zero meter MI calibrated to indicate the difference in thickness #h. The apparatus is zeroised by adjusting slider 11 for zero difference indicating when the separating force, roller setting, and required thickness are alike zero. The resistance drum 3 o may be replaced by a disc, rotatable direct or through gearing or through a magslip transmission from screw 27, having a resistance wire round the periphery, while the output of amplifier 16 may operate a pen recorder inscribing the varying thickness of emergent strip over the length of a run. The signals which are to be combined may be derived in terms of other physical quantities e.g. fluid pressures or mechanical displacements whose values are derived in accordance with the requisite variables.
